Description
A cozy comforting drop garlic cheddar drop biscuit recipe that is ready to eat in under 30 minutes.
Ingredients
2 1/2 cups ( grams) all purpose flour, preferably White Lily
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up (2 ounces) vegetable shortening
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 cup ( 8 ounces) milk, cold
1 cup (4 ounces) shredded sharp cheddar cheese
1/2 cup (4 ounces) unsalted butter melted
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
Instructions
-
Preheat the oven to 450ºF.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
-
In a large bowl wh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t and garlic powder.
-
Cut in the vegetable shortening, with a pastry cutter, your hands or a pair of forks. The flour mixture should have crumbs the size of peas. Toss in the shredded cheese.
-
Create a well in the bowl and pour cold milk in the center. Stir the flour until the dough comes together. Don’t over stir.
-
Use a cookie scoop or greased tablespoon to drop the biscuits on to the prepared baking sheet.
-
Bake for 9-11 minutes. The tops of the biscuits should be a light golden color.
-
In a small bowl whisk together the melted butter, salt and garlic powder. Generously brush the tops of the biscuits with the garlic butter.
-
Serve hot.
